1 Low Voltage Power Supply Specification DCS Workshop 8 Sept 03 L.Jirden

2 Electrical Characteristics u AC Input u 230 VAC +- 10%, 50 HZ +- 6%, PF >0.9 u DC Output u Modular design LV PS 2 – 7 V, 125 A 8 outputs/crate LV PS 2 – 7 V, 25 A 12 outputs/crate 24h stability < 5mV or 0.1% 6m stability < 20mV or 0.5% Noise & ripple < 10mV p to p

11 OPC SERVER u General u Compliance with OPC standards u No effect on PS output due to failure of remote control u Restart of OPC remotely u Not send set points automatically at startup – read from device u PS shall maintain its set points during PS power failure? u Genuine device and cache access u Interactive list of device functions

12 OPC SERVER u Maintenance u To support future versions of Windows and OPC standards u To support future versions of PS firmware u Configuration u Allow appropriate management of the fieldbus u Human readable configuration file (such as XML) u Obtain actual configuration by scanning u Setting of ranges for analog values and setting of the dead band

13 OPC SERVER u Performance u Change in Device to OPC:max 10 sec at full bus load max 1 sec for a single PS u Device cache to OPC client:max 3 sec for all parameters u Write from OPC to device:max 1 sec u Interlock to start ramp-down:max 5 ms

14 u Cooling u Forced air u Environment u Radiation< 0.01 Gy< 10 8 n/cm 2 u Magnetic Field< 80 Gauss u Construction u Halogen free material u Safety regulations u CE certification u Reliability u MTBF > hours

15 u Quality assurance u Production tests u Functional tests u Load tests u Documentation u User’s guide u Reference manual u Test and calibration reports
